lib/foreplay.rb in foreplay-0.17.0 vs lib/foreplay.rb in foreplay-0.17.1

- old
+ new

@@ -48,11 +48,11 @@ end end # Some useful additions to the String class class String - colors = %w(black red green yellow blue magenta cyan white) + colors = %w[black red green yellow blue magenta cyan white] colors.each_with_index do |fg_color, i| fg = 30 + i define_method(fg_color) { ansi_attributes(fg) } @@ -64,10 +64,10 @@ def ansi_attributes(*args) "\e[#{args.join(';')}m#{self}\e[0m" end def fake_erb - gsub(/(<%=\s+([^%]+)\s+%>)/) { |e| eval "_ = #{e.split[1]}" } + gsub(/(<%=\s+([^%]+)\s+%>)/) { |e| eval "_ = #{e.split[1]}" } # rubocop:disable Security/Eval end def escape_double_quotes gsub('"', '\\"') end